Herpes zoster (shingles): what is it, symptoms, causes and treatment?

Herpes zoster is a virus also known as shingles, which produces severe pain and itching as its main symptoms.  Find out everything there is to know about him.

Herpes zoster is a disease caused by the varicella-zoster virus (VZV). It has a high degree of incidence, especially in adults, and is characterized by the appearance of skin rashes in the form of blisters or warts on many areas of the body. Due to its more than notorious form, this virus is also known as shingles or also as “San Antonio fire“.

This virus has the same composition as the chickenpox virus and therefore has a somewhat similar way of behaving that can spread through all the nerve ganglia that later turn into those annoying herpes. Once this is known, we are going to unravel the main causes that may be behind shingles.

Causes of shingles

First of all, it goes without saying that this infection is usually caught in childhood through a series of reddish rashes known as chickenpox. Over the years, this infection can become a “breeding ground” for this type of herpes. From there, the causes behind this virus can be the following:

  • Low immune system. Once the person’s defenses stop working normally, this leads to the appearance of shingles. Hence, it is a more common infection in people of advanced age.
  • Some medications when undergoing some treatments such as chemotherapy.

Symptoms of shingles

Next we are going to emphasize the different symptoms that may be behind shingles, among which the following should be highlighted. In the first place, a multitude of painful vesicles appear that are deposited on all the lumbar and thoracic nerves and even throughout the area of ​​the eye socket.

As a consequence, it is very possible that large blisters form, which can later burst or disappear in painful scabs. If they don’t heal properly, this can later lead to more serious skin infections that need to be treated as soon as possible.

Likewise, the appearance of these rashes can also cause disorders in our gastrointestinal system. Headaches may even appear accompanied by high fever and general malaise.  Finally, the intense pain also occurs in the entire herpes area that can appear even before the appearance of the blisters.
